Using dew point temperature in the process control as the control parameter what benefits?

The dew point temperature is a useful parameter in industrial applications, because it is not affected by temperature changes.It is usually used to measure the dry degree in application of dry, such applications of low relative humidity (RH), and the need to add wet space or in a controlled environment to maintain under the condition of high humidity, understand the dew point temperature is also very useful.Suppose you have a higher relative humidity in space or application, you need to maintain the stable temperature at the same time to the space humidification, drying, or in stable temperature while maintaining a constant high humidity.At this time will not be able to use relative humidity as control parameter, because it is influenced by temperature.Instead, use the dew point temperature as the control parameters can be very effective.
